How much do computer sales rep j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for computer sales rep in Omaha, NE is $73,355.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$51,200.00 and $89,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a computer sales rep do?

A Computer Sales Representative is responsible for selling computers, hardware, software, and related technology products to customers. They assist clients by explaining product features, answering technical questions, and recommending solutions that fit the customer's needs. Computer Sales Reps often work in retail stores or for technology companies, and may also handle after-sales support and follow-up. Their goal is to help customers make informed purchasing decisions and achieve sales targets for their employ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a computer sales rep,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Computer Sales Rep, you need strong knowledge of computer hardware and software, sales techniques, and typically a background in business or technology. Familiarity with CRM software, inventory management systems, and product demonstration tools is often required. Excellent communication, active listening, and relationship-building skills help you connect with customers and close deals. These skills are vital to effectively match products to customer needs, achieve sales targets, and build lasting client relationships in a competitive market.

How does a computer sales rep typically work with technical support and product specialists to address customer needs?

Computer Sales Reps often collaborate closely with technical support teams and product specialists to provide accurate information and solutions to customers. When customers have questions about product compatibility, installation, or technical features, Sales Reps coordinate with these experts to ensure the customer's needs are fully understood and addressed. This teamwork helps build customer trust and enables Sales Reps to offer tailored recommendations, making collaboration a key aspect of the role. Effective communication and the ability to relay customer feedback to technical teams are essential skills in this environment.

What is the difference between Computer Sales Rep vs Computer Support Specialist?

AspectComputer Sales RepComputer Support Specialist
CredentialsHigh school diploma; sales experience often preferredHigh school diploma; certifications like CompTIA A+ beneficial
Work EnvironmentRetail stores, showrooms, or online sales platformsHelp desks, technical support centers, or client sites
Employer & IndustryElectronics retailers, tech companies, telecom providersIT service providers, corporate IT departments, tech support firms
Search & Comparison IntentCustomer sales, product knowledge, sales techniquesTechnical troubleshooting, problem resolution, system setup

While both roles involve working with computers, a Computer Sales Rep primarily focuses on selling computer products and advising customers, whereas a Computer Support Specialist provides technical assistance and troubleshooting. The roles differ in skills, environment, and daily tasks, but both are essential in the tech industry.

How to get into a computer sales representative career?

To become a computer sales representative, gaining knowledge of computer hardware and software is essential, often through a high school diploma or equivalent. Developing strong communication and customer service skills, gaining experience in retail or sales, and understanding sales techniques can improve job prospects; certifications in IT or sales can also be beneficial.
